As shown in fig. 1, a rice seedling raising device comprises a base 1 and a vertical rod 2 arranged on the base 1, wherein the vertical rod 2 is sequentially provided with four square trays 5 for seedling raising from top to bottom, a seedling raising cavity is formed in the top surface of each square tray 5, and a plurality of grooves 51 are formed in the bottom surface of the seedling raising cavity. One side surface of each square tray 5 is provided with a drain hole at the position corresponding to the bottom of the seedling culture cavity, and a plug is arranged in the drain hole to facilitate draining of redundant seedling culture water. Each square tray 5 is provided with a rotating part 3 at the middle position of one side surface thereof, the rotating part 3 is of a shaft sleeve structure, the inner diameter of the rotating part 3 is arranged corresponding to the diameter of the upright stanchion 2, the rotating part 3 is rotatably arranged on the upright stanchion 2, a sleeve 4 is sleeved between every two adjacent rotating parts 3 of the upright stanchion 2, the two adjacent rotating parts 3 are separated by the sleeve 4, while supporting the rotating member 3 located above, in this embodiment, the rotating member 3 at the lowest end contacts with the top surface of the base 1, three sleeves 4 are provided on the vertical rod 2, three through holes corresponding to one sleeve 4 are provided on the vertical rod 2 from top to bottom, two fixing holes are provided on the side wall of each sleeve 4, each through hole is provided corresponding to two fixing holes of one sleeve 4, the through hole and the two fixing holes are provided with locking bolts 9 in a penetrating mode, the locking bolts 9 are matched with locking nuts, and the sleeve 4 and the vertical rod 2 are stably connected. The working principle of the device is that firstly rice seeds are scattered into the grooves 51 of each square tray 5, then a proper amount of culture water is added into the square trays 5, the culture water only needs to ensure that the rice seeds are soaked in the culture water, then wet cloth is covered on the seeds, seedling culture water is sprayed in due time according to the wettability of the wet cloth, and the humidity of the seeds is ensured. Treat that the seed sprouts and remove wet cloth, sprout to a leaf one heart growth in-process at the seed and notice temperature control, treat that the seedling is long to two leaves one heart when, need carry out the illumination, can rotate the position that is located three square tray 5 in top in order this moment, realize four directions all around and arrange a square tray 5 respectively, guarantee that the seedling is sufficient sunshine volume in every square tray 5 to promote its growth. After the illumination is finished, the square trays 5 are turned to the initial state, namely, the four square trays are stacked from top to bottom, and the space is saved.
In this embodiment, when square tray 5 stacks when the state, 2 one side atress of pole setting is great, for improving this device stability, each square tray 5 articulates through the hinge pin 8 that a level set up separately in two next-door neighbour's side departments that rotate 3 has bracing piece 7, also exactly the bracing piece 7 bottom articulates on square tray 5 side through hinge pin 8, there is the supporting part this 7 tops of bracing piece to 5 directional buckling of tray, arc draw-in groove 52 that each square tray 5 bottom surface was seted up and is rotated 3 concentricity and correspond with the bracing piece 7 supporting part, two sides of square tray are extended at arc draw-in groove 52 both ends, when guaranteeing square tray 5 and rotate, the supporting part smoothly inserts. When the trays 5 are stacked, the supporting parts 7 of the supporting rods located below the square trays 5 are inserted into the arc-shaped clamping grooves 52 of the square trays 5 adjacent to the square trays 5 above the square trays, the top surfaces of the supporting parts are tightly attached to the bottoms of the arc-shaped clamping grooves, and the supporting rods 7 support the upper trays 5. In this embodiment, in order to improve the stability of the whole device, the base 1 is provided with a support block for supporting the lowermost square tray 5. When seedling illumination in square tray, bracing piece 7 loses support function, accomodate for bracing piece 7 to square tray, each square tray 5 is equipped with L template 6 in the side that sets up bracing piece 7, this L template 6 and 5 sides of square tray form the opening upwards, a U type groove structure for accomodating bracing piece 7, the groove of dodging that corresponds with the supporting part is seted up to the one end that sets up bracing piece 7 to 5 top surfaces of square tray, dodge the groove and grow seedlings the chamber and not communicate, when bracing piece 7 level was placed, the supporting part was shelved and is dodging the inslot.
In this embodiment, in order to move the whole device, the base 1 is provided with a roller for movement.
